Tempered glass

Tempered glass is one the most durable varieties. It can be used in numerous applications, such as table tops, shelves and shower enclosures. Tempered glass is four to five times stronger than regular annealed.

Tempered glass is more secure and less prone to break into dangerous shreds. This is a benefit especially for homes with small children. Tempered glass is small and oval-shaped. These shards are easily cleaned and are safe.

Tempered glass is the best choice for glass replacement glass window pane at home. Not only is it safer but also more affordable than comparable products like laminated glass.

There are two options to consider for replacing your windows: tempered or annealed. Making a decision between the two is determined by your needs and budget.

Although annealed glass can be found in older houses, it doesn't come with as many security features. Annealed glass is more fragile than tempered glass , and breaks into large pieces that are irregular and large.

When windows are concerned, a tempered glass is ideal for both businesses and homes. Tempered glass is more durable and is able to withstand the force of an intruder. It will not split into sharp, large parts.

Tempered glass is more durable than annealed glass and can be able to withstand head-on collisions more effectively than annealed. It also prevents sharp edges from forming. Moreover, tempered glass is simpler to clean and maintain.

Tempered glass is typically called "safety" glass due to the fact that it is resistant to breaking. Tempered glass is particularly useful in places that have high risks of injury.

Laminate glass

There are a variety of replacement window panes double glass glass, but the most common is laminate glass. It is more robust than standard glass and is safer.

Laminate glass is composed of two sheets of glass joined by an interlayer of plastic that holds them together. The interlayer shields the glass from breakage and also provides other features.

Laminate glass is stronger than glass that is tempered, and less likely to be broken into pieces. Because laminated glass is harder to penetrate, it's more secure.

In addition to offering protection from wind and hail and hail, laminated glass can also block unwanted noise from piercing your home. It is a popular choice for skylights and tall structures and also those that are near golf courses or airports.
